There may also be some … Web29 sep. 2024 · One of the easiest ways to toast friends and family is to say "L'Chayim" (pronounced "li-KHAY-eem"). Translated literally from the Hebrew or Yiddish, the toast means "To life." This is the go-to toast …

There are several Jewish and Hebrew greetings, farewells, and phrases that are used in Judaism, and in Jewish and Hebrew-speaking communities around the world. Even outside Israel, Hebrew is an important part of Jewish life. Many Jews, even if they do not speak Hebrew fluently, will know several of these greetings (most are Hebrew, and among Ashkenazim some are Yiddish).
